'The noise is unbearable': Cork resident objects to Joshua Tree bar garden room

The resident, who is 83 years old, said Gardai are frequently called due to antisocial and drunken disorderly behaviour
Plans to retain a garden room extension at a Cork City pub have been appealed to An Coimisiún Pleanála.
Pub owner William Creagh received the green light from the city council in July to retain a single-story garden room extension at the Joshua Tree Bar at 69-70 Blarney Street.
